Larrikin Tours
History can be fun and exciting with Sydney's only Larrikin Tour.
Brian, your Host, is a fourth generation local Larrikin who will entertain you with tales of past and present local characters who make this historic area so colourful.
He will enthrall you with stories and gossip as he reminisces about his life growing up in the birthplace of the nation, The Rocks.
Discover cobblestone lanes and courtyards hidden from the public eye.
As you stroll around The Rocks you may bump into a colourful local identity. Hear the stories of "Biggles", "Jimmy the Woodman" and many more.
Discover where the name "Larrikin" came from. Book in for this Larrikin Tour if you want to meet a local with a twinkle in his eye, who likes a bit of mischief!
Tours are available during the day - seven days a week, you choose the date and time and bring your camera along.
